The annual salary statistics of automotive and watercraft service attendants in Baltimore-Towson, Maryland is shown in Table 1. The wage statistics of automotive and watercraft service attendants in Baltimore-Towson is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].
| Percentile Bracket | Average Annual Salary |
|---|---|
| 10th Percentile Wage | $26,000 |
| 25th Percentile Wage | $28,690 |
| 50th Percentile Wage | $29,590 |
| 75th Percentile Wage | $34,560 |
| 90th Percentile Wage | $39,650 |
Table 1 shows the average annual salary for automotive and watercraft service attendants in Baltimore-Towson, Maryland in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$39,650.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$29,590.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$26,000.
The table and chart below show the trend of the median salary of automotive and watercraft service attendants from 2012 to 2022.
| Year | Median Salary | Yearly Growth | 10-Year Growth |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2022 | $29,590 | 1.66% | 35.35% |
| 2021 | $29,100 | 5.12% | - |
| 2020 | $27,610 | 4.27% | - |
| 2019 | $26,430 | 5.30% | - |
| 2018 | $25,030 | 12.31% | - |
| 2017 | $21,950 | 10.39% | - |
| 2016 | $19,670 | -1.02% | - |
| 2015 | $19,870 | -6.84% | - |
| 2014 | $21,230 | 0.57% | - |
| 2013 | $21,110 | 9.38% | - |
| 2012 | $19,130 | - | - |
